*USER EXPERIENCE ARCHITECTS (3 SPOTS)*

Pittsburgh, PA

6 month contract



Key skills: *User Interface design, HTML/CSS, JQuery, Photoshop, web
application, e-commerce, excellent communication and presentation skills.*



*The client is looking for the following background and skills:*

* Bachelor degree, focus on HCI or relevant prior experience;

* At least 3-5 years web-based information architecture or interaction
design experience with a focus on website, mobile and eCommerce;

* Solid foundation in web-based technologies including HTML/CSS, jQuery,
Browser/OS compliance, high-level 508 compliance;

* Prior experience designing for (and across) varied integrated business
systems for both internal and external audiences (content management
systems, eCommerce systems, marketing automation platforms);

* Proficiency with UX tools (Visio, Axure, Morae, MindMap, others);

* Experience using Photoshop, Illustrator, and the MS Office suite;

* Experience participating in research and testing efforts;

* The ability to lead and participate in discovery/UX sessions;

* The ability to educate internal teams throughout the business on best
practices/standards, with the ability to effectively drive the
standardization and integration of those recommendations;

* Ability to work within a cross-functional team of content specialists,
digital designers and IT to developed highly optimized user experiences
across digital channels;

* Exceptional understanding of UX best practices, and how they apply to web
and application development needs across varied projects (website,
eCommerce, mobile interfaces, digital marketing);

* Understanding of web technologies to drive interface and experiential
recommendations;

* Strong understanding of communication, interaction, and motion design
with how it apply to web technologies in various delivery channels;

* Solid understanding of creative and development disciplines and how to
apply UX principles;

* Ability to manage multiple projects across teams, including timelines,
deliverables, budgets and hours;

* Understanding of analytics, and how UX efforts lead to measureable KPIs
and measurement;

* Ability to quickly and effectively learn business process and how they
apply to digital efforts;

* Ability to understand scope and requirements to drive innovative
solutions;

* Anticipate potential project problems and create solutions or contingency
plans; and

* Strong team player, with ability to mentor and educate team members
across the business.



*These contractors will assist in the following:*

* Designs pattern development, standardization;

* Navigation & search standards, implementation;

* Controlled vocabulary system development;

* Browser and interaction design standards;

* Persona, scenario, use case development & standardization;

* Prototypes, sitemaps, and wireframes;

* Content and interface strategies, along with how they map to user
personas/requirements and measurable KPIs;

* Content and interface requirements for both structured and unstructured
content;

* Functional requirement development, documentation;

* Participate in creative concept development including (but not limited
to) discovery sessions, user profiles/personas, user scenarios,
organizational models, task models, features list;

* Participate in project definition activities including business
requirement gathering, competitive analysis/assessment, secondary research,
voice of customer sessions, user testing, user surveying; and

* Create process flows, site maps, wireframes, screen prototypes and
functional specifications.
